## Onboarding: MergePoint Deduplication Service

MergePoint resolves duplicate customer records for the Quillbrook platform using probabilistic matching with manual review fallback. All merge decisions are logged immutably for audit purposes. Should the review console become inaccessible, operators restore access via the sealed recovery flow; the flow prompts for the recovery passphrase recorded immediately below this paragraph.

unlock words, kahif-bajep: druix-sormir-fenys

# Runbook: Hunting leaked file descriptors in Quillgate

When the `fd_open` gauge climbs steadily between deploys, suspect a leak rather than load. First confirm on a single pod: exec in and count entries under `/proc/1/fd`, noting how many are sockets in CLOSE_WAIT versus regular files. Capture two snapshots ten minutes apart before restarting anything — we need the delta for the postmortem. Reproduce locally with the Marbury load harness, which requires the service running with the following configuration values.

settings of yagep-bajog:
[istdor]
port = 4000
region = south-2
host = istdor.qorvelcorp.internal
timeout_ms = 5000
retries = 5

- [ ] Step 7: Archive cold storage buckets (Glacierline tier). Confirm both ceremony witnesses are present, verify bucket manifests match the Oxbow ledger, then seal the archive key shares. Plugin authors may observe but not handle shares. Once sealed, the archive index itself is encrypted and can only be reopened with the passphrase below.

vault phrase of badup-hahig = tamael-aldael-kelmir-istael-fenok-istwyn-tamius-jorath-oliion

Minutes — Management Meeting, Budget Request Review

Present: the executive committee and Ms. Orlen. The committee reviewed the Tarrowgate division's request for expanded tooling funds. Discussion covered payback assumptions, vendor quotes, and phasing options. A revised figure was conditionally approved pending audit of last year's capital usage. The board is asked to note the confidential context recorded below.

internal memo for kawip-hadug: Headcount on the Wenwyn team goes from 7 to 140 by the end of January. Gross margin on Wenwyn came in at 20 percent against a plan of 15 percent.